+/* Helper function to check if the lock is acquired */
+static inline int is_lock_acquired(const bakery_info_t *my_bakery_info,
+ int is_cached)
+{
+ /*
+ * Even though lock data is updated only by the owning cpu and
+ * appropriate cache maintenance operations are performed,
+ * if the previous update was done when the cpu was not participating
+ * in coherency, then there is a chance that cache maintenance
+ * operations were not propagated to all the caches in the system.
+ * Hence do a `read_cache_op()` prior to read.
+ */
+ read_cache_op(my_bakery_info, is_cached);
+ return !!(bakery_ticket_number(my_bakery_info->lock_data));
+}
